Today I'm so pumped to be chatting with Gianni Bianco - certified personal trainer, founder of GB Wellness, and creator of the She Girls Club here in Las Vegas. Gianni takes a psychological approach to fitness with the belief that health starts in your mind and the body will follow, which I absolutely love. We dive into her incredible journey from bodybuilding competitor at 18 to building a thriving coaching business focused on sustainable, enjoyable fitness. Gianni gets real about the mental battles of extreme dieting, why slow and steady wins the race, and how she's creating a supportive women-only fitness community. We also talk macro tracking, overcoming imposter syndrome as a trainer, and why saying no is actually a superpower.
